Note on Marriage

In 1910, Fred, Ida and Lilian were staying with the Denham's - ie his sister Mabel's family - in Bristol, Massachusetts. Fred, like his brother-in-law, was a bench hand at a jewellery shop.

 

In 1920, Fred rented a house in Woonsocket, Providence, Rhode Island. He was a tool maker in a tool shop, perhaps working with his brother Charles, who did the same work in the same area.

 

His registration card for WWII showed that he was still in Woonsocket, Rhode Island at that time. He mentioned Ida as his next-of-kin. He was 5 ft 6 with brown eyes, grey hair and a light complexion.
